Placerville Speedway Ignites Independence Day with Racing and Fireworks Extravaganza

Placerville Speedway in California is gearing up for an exciting week of racing, headlined by their Fourth of July Spectacular event on Thursday. The evening promises high-speed thrills as three racing divisions – the Thompson’s Family of Dealerships Winged 360 Sprint Cars, the Mountain Democrat Ltd. Late Models, and the Red Hawk Casino Pure Stocks – take to the track.

Red Hawk Casino Night: More Racing, More Fun

The excitement continues on July 6th with Red Hawk Casino Night, featuring a four-division championship program. The Thompson’s Winged 360 Sprint Cars will be joined by the USAC Western States Midgets, the Red Hawk Casino Pure Stocks, and the BCRA Wingless Lightning Sprints, promising a diverse and action-packed night of racing.
